I had the same issue a few years back, but the pit was aggressive towards my wife and kids as well as my dogs. He nearly knocked out the planks of the fence.
I talked w/ my neighbor. He kept the dog inside from then on until a few months later when he got rid of it. (Turns out he was keeping it for a kid. He wasn't very fond of the dog.)
Hopefully, your neighbor will be reasonable, if not call animal control, and document, document, document. Get videos of the their dogs behavior.
If they "accidently" get into your yard and you have to take action, it may help w legal issues later.
